• 关于我们
  • 产品
  • 教程
  • 数字货币
Sign in Get Started

                          深入解析以太坊钱包开发视频:从基础到实践2025-05-29 20:19:28

                          随着区块链技术的不断发展,以太坊(Ethereum)作为一个开源的区块链平台,以其智能合约功能受到广泛关注。以太坊钱包是用户与以太坊网络交互的重要工具,承担着安全存储以太坊及其代币的职责。近年来,越来越多的开发者开始关注以太坊钱包的开发,制作了各类开发视频教学,帮助新手快速上手,掌握必要的知识与技能。

                          在本文中,我们将深入探讨以太坊钱包开发视频的内容结构、重点知识、资源推荐等方面,帮助读者全方位了解如何从零起步进行以太坊钱包的开发。同时,我们还会回答一些常见的相关问题,帮助开发者解答在学习过程中可能遇到的疑惑。

                          一、以太坊钱包的基本概念

                          以太坊钱包,顾名思义,是专为以太坊及其代币(如ERC-20标准代币)设计的数字钱包。它允许用户安全地存储、接收和发送以太坊。这类钱包通常分为三种类型:热钱包、冷钱包和硬件钱包。

                          热钱包是指与互联网连接的数字钱包,操作方便,适合频繁交易;而冷钱包则是离线钱包,适合长时间存储资产,相对安全。硬件钱包则是物理设备,通常是通过USB接口连接计算机,提供更强的安全性。

                          在开发以太坊钱包的过程中,开发者需要熟悉相关技术,如以太坊网络结构、智能合约、非对称加密技术等。视频教程通常会涵盖这些基本概念,并逐步引导观众进行实践。

                          二、以太坊钱包开发的视频结构

                          以太坊钱包开发视频通常具有系统性和结构化的特点,让新手能够按照步骤逐步学习。以下是常见的视频内容结构:

                          1. 课程概述: 简要介绍以太坊钱包以及钱包开发的目的和重要性。
                          2. 环境准备: 指导观众如何搭建开发环境,安装必要的软件和工具,确保能够高效进行开发工作。
                          3. 以太坊基础: 讲解以太坊网络的核心概念,如以太坊虚拟机(EVM)、智能合约等。
                          4. 钱包接口开发: 逐步讲解如何使用Web3.js等库与以太坊网络交互。
                          5. 用户界面设计: 如何设计用户友好的界面,提升用户体验。
                          6. 安全性措施: 强调在钱包开发过程中需要关注的安全问题,讲解如何保护用户资产。
                          7. 项目部署与实践: 最后一步是将钱包项目部署到真实环境中,并进行测试。

                          三、实用资源与推荐

                          为了帮助开发者更好地掌握以太坊钱包的开发,以下是一些推荐的资源:

                          • 在线课程: 诸如Coursera、Udemy等平台提供包含以太坊开发的课程,持久更新,内容涵盖开发的方方面面。
                          • 开源项目: GitHub上有很多开源的以太坊钱包项目,开发者可以通过阅读代码和文档学习。
                          • 开发者社区: 论坛如Stack Overflow、Ethereum Stack Exchange能够提供及时的技术支持。
                          • 官方文档: 以太坊官网有详实的文档和开发指南,可以作为学习的重要参考资料。

                          四、常见问题解答

                          如何选择合适的以太坊钱包开发框架?

                          选择适合的框架对于以太坊钱包开发至关重要。常见的开发框架如Truffle、Hardhat以及Drizzle都各有其特点:

                          Truffle是一个功能强大的以太坊开发框架,提供了智能合约的编译、部署、测试等工具,适合需要高度自动化的团队。

                          Hardhat是一个较新但极具潜力的框架,强调灵活性和可扩展性,适用于关注开发与测试的开发者。

                          Drizzle则是以太坊钱包开发的前端框架,专注于前端与区块链的交互,适合构建用户界面。选择时,可以考虑自身团队的技能基础、项目要求和长期维护等因素。

                          此外,还应关注社区支持与文档更新,保证在使用过程中遇到问题时能够及时获得帮助。

                          以太坊钱包开发过程中需要注意哪些安全性问题?

                          安全性问题是以太坊钱包开发的重中之重,开发者必须采取多种措施确保用户资产的安全:

                          私钥保护: 私钥是用户数字资产的唯一凭证,开发者不应将私钥暴露在代码中。应使用加密和分离存储等方法进行保护。

                          多重签名: 使用多重签名机制,可以增加安全性,确保每次交易都需要多个权限者的批准,从而避免单点故障。

                          审计与测试: 定期进行安全审计、代码审计,确保没有漏洞和安全隐患。同时进行全面测试也十分关键,包括单元测试和集成测试。

                          及时更新: 不断更新库和框架到最新版本,减少因安全漏洞而被攻击的风险。

                          开发以太坊钱包的前端界面应如何设计?

                          用户界面的设计对于以太坊钱包的用户体验至关重要。设计时的几个关键点包括:

                          简洁明了: 界面应简洁明了,避免复杂的操作流程,让用户能够快速上手。使用直观的图标和文本提示可以增加友好度。

                          响应式设计: 随着移动设备的普及,确保钱包在各类屏幕上都能良好展示,提供一致的用户体验。

                          反馈与提示: 用户在进行交易、操作时,系统应及时反馈操作结果,减少用户不安与疑惑。

                          安全提示: 在敏感操作时,如转账、大额交易时,提醒用户进行确认和警示,增强安全意识。

                          以太坊钱包的未来发展趋势是什么?

                          在区块链技术快速发展的今天,以太坊钱包也面临着许多新的挑战与机遇:

                          跨链技术的崛起: 随着多条公链的出现,用户希望能够在不同链之间进行资产流转,高效的跨链钱包将会成为未来的趋势。

                          去中心化金融(DeFi)与非同质化代币(NFT): DeFi和NFT的流行将推动钱包的功能多样化,钱包不仅仅是资产存储,更是参与金融活动和数字艺术交易的入口。

                          用户身份管理: 随着区块链技术的广泛应用,钱包有望成为用户身份与数字资产的集合点,整合身份认证功能。

                          更强的隐私保护: 用户对隐私的重视将促进隐私保护技术的发展,增强用户账户安全性及隐私性。

                          综上所述,以太坊钱包的开发视频为学习者提供了丰富的学习资源,通过结构化的内容分步推进,结合实际案例和安全策略,使得新手开发者能够在较短时间内上手开发。随着技术的演进,值得关注的趋势也在不断变化,开发者们应保持敏锐的观察与学习热情。

                          注册我们的时事通讯

                          我们的进步

                          本周热门

                          如何选择和使用数字货币
                          如何选择和使用数字货币
                          注册以太坊钱包官网入口
                          注册以太坊钱包官网入口
                          请注意:由于内容篇幅限
                          请注意:由于内容篇幅限
                          如何使用C语言生成以太坊
                          如何使用C语言生成以太坊
                          以下是为您准备的内容:
                          以下是为您准备的内容:

                              地址

                              Address : 1234 lock, Charlotte, North Carolina, United States

                              Phone : +12 534894364

                              Email : info@example.com

                              Fax : +12 534894364

                              快速链接

                              • 关于我们
                              • 产品
                              • 教程
                              • 数字货币
                              • tpwallet官方app下载
                              • tp官方正版下载

                              通讯

                              通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

                              tpwallet官方app下载

                              tpwallet官方app下载是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
                              我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,tpwallet官方app下载都是您信赖的选择。

                              • facebook
                              • twitter
                              • google
                              • linkedin

                              2003-2025 tp交易所app下载 @版权所有|网站地图|皖ICP备10205403号-6

                                        
                                            
                                        Login Now
                                        We'll never share your email with anyone else.

                                        Don't have an account?

                                                          Register Now

                                                          By clicking Register, I agree to your terms